Everything But The House Reviews Summary

The company has garnered a mixed reputation, with some customers praising the quality of unique items and positive experiences with customer service. However, a significant number of reviews highlight serious concerns, including inflated shipping costs, poor communication, and issues with product authenticity. Many customers report dissatisfaction with the handling of returns and complaints, often facing unresponsive support. Overall, while there are pockets of positive feedback, the prevailing sentiment suggests a decline in service quality and transparency, leading to frustration among long-time users and potential legal actions from dissatisfied customers.

I recently attended an event at the Columbus (Ohio) Museum of Art which featured EBTH. The main speaker from EBTH Cincinnati was very good and interesting. However, when attendees were able to bring up our vintage and antique items for a quick appraisal, a manager from the Columbus office laid a large, old medical chart on top of my item. A significant amount of black dust and stain came off of the chart and onto my Popeye doll from the 1950s. The doll was in Very Good condition but now has black staining on its clothing which is not coming off.

While the manager did apologize to me, he only did so after prompting and when he became aware other people had seen what happened. He certainly did not sound or appear apologetic in any way. His only response was that he could look up the value of my item on his computer after he finished with the medical chart. I definitely had the impression he viewed me and the Popeye as unimportant.

I understand my item isn't worth thousands of dollars. But it was something I had planned to sell and it's value has been significantly decreased by the careless mishandling by EBTH staff.

Our names, phone numbers, and objects for review were recorded so I waited a day to post this review to see if I would perhaps receive an apology call of some type. I did not.

I had previously recommended EBTH multiple times especially to people who had high quality items they wished to see as part of downsizing to move to a retirement community. I will now only be recommending other online auction companies and sites.

Take care when identifying the object you are bidding on. The auction site cannot be "all knowing" any more than a live auctioneer can be an expert on all types of glassware, pottery or antiques. You must use your own expertise and research as you are bidding and assume the ultimate responsibility. I have been very pleased with the items I have purchased although one item was lost and never received and 1 purchase delivery was delayed to the point I was afraid it was also lost. This is a fabulous way to have an eye on items across the nation that I otherwise would never have seen nor had a chance to bid on or to own. Most of the items I have purchased have been delicate in nature (glassware) and I have had no damage whatsoever!

Photos Make Jewelry Look Substantial but sadly when you receive you find that is not the case. I purchased a garnet ring that looked online to be suitable for a grown women to wear but when it arrived, it was so incredibly small. It looked like something a 12 year old girl would wear. I called in to Customer Service and they politely told me that their descriptions were accurate which I am sure they were but that basically I am stuck with the ring because unlike eBay where most sellers offer returns or make it plan if they don't, EBTH is a "as is - where is" site and once you buy, you keep. I am not alleging that their description was inaccurate. I am saying their photos make jewelry look to a layman (who doesn't know how big or in this case small a 6mm garnet really is) like it is more than it is. I suggested to Customer Service that they might want to photograph a ring on a woman's hand to show true size. Not sure if that will make it's way up the food chain or if they are interested in a more proper representation or not. I certainly would NEVER had paid $90 for this tiny little ring. Had it been photographed on a woman's hand, I would have known what I was considering and passed. I understand this is the perils of shopping on line. Again, ebay is the better site since most ebay sellers offer refunds. If you don't like or something doesn't live up to expectations, you can return for refund.
